Transaction e5c3f6d838b8e371be80957cdbcc64019c20ef54991930c6d7b4cdf1c56c06ae

1 Input
2 Outputs
  • e5c3f6d838b8e371be80957cdbcc64019c20ef54991930c6d7b4cdf1c56c06ae:0
  • value  114941
    address  1968E7SaZHQLhDabXdVVByn9uMFrUQ3avF
  • e5c3f6d838b8e371be80957cdbcc64019c20ef54991930c6d7b4cdf1c56c06ae:1
  • value  937809
    address  3BRF5vbPhzBuqCwR2ZfUZ3oXRM67Bsf9gD